Abstract

Ayurveda has evolved with the inputs from the then existing philosophical thoughts and has modified so as to suit its purpose. Satkaryavada (Theory of Existence) and Asatkaryavada (Theory of Non-existence) are two basic philosophical theories explain the concept of causality. The concept of causality is the base of the diagnosis and management of diseases in accordance to Ayurveda principles. Therefore these two principles have been used to understand the Ayurveda concepts of Prakruti Sama Samaveta and Vikruti Vishama Samaveta. The Prakruti Sama Samaveta and Vikruti Vishama Samaveta form the foundation of diagnosis and treatment principle of Ayurveda.
